## Approvals: Public API Pagination

Any change to pagination behavior in the Ferngate public REST API — page size limits, cursor format, or default ordering — is a contract change and requires approval before release. Release managers must not ship pagination changes on a patch version. Attach the approval record to the release ticket. The required approver is listed below.

named custodian: Brivan Eliath Quenox Frador

## SQL Linting — Ferrowave Team

All SQL files pass through squintcheck pre-commit. Rules: uppercase keywords, no SELECT *, explicit JOINs, snake_case identifiers. CI blocks merges on violations. The linter validates queries against a live schema snapshot; point it at the lint sandbox using the connection string below.

primary connection of yagep-kahip = redis://giliel_svc:zYiKsLL2PLpfPL@db-348f.xolmarsys.corp:5432/fenwyn

## Runbook: Transcode farm release (weekly sync notes)

Quick recap for Thursday: the Pellagrin transcode farm ships on a two-stage rollout — canary the Osterfeld cluster first, then fan out if the queue depth stays under 2k for an hour. Heads up that the worker images are now signed at build time, so if a node refuses to pull, it's almost always a verification mismatch, not networking. Re-run the attestation check before paging anyone. For the image verification step, use the key included directly below.

signing key of bagap-yawep = bky13_TbfT6ZMUoGJo2

### RestockPilot: Release Prerequisites

Before cutting a release, confirm that the RestockPilot planner can reach the SnackGrid inventory service, since the build pipeline runs an integration smoke test against staging during packaging. A failed handshake here blocks the release tag, so verify credentials first. The pipeline reads its staging credential from the deploy config; for reference and manual verification, the current key appears below.

service key, tajof-fawip: vxb4-JNOz